About conditions applications

How this application type works

This type of application deals with conditions attached to an existing permission, either by supplying the details a condition requires, called discharging it, or by asking to vary or remove one. It does not reopen the principle of the permission itself. Building often cannot lawfully start, or continue past a set stage, until the named conditions are discharged.

    Non-material minor amendment to planning consent 3009/24/FUL to reconfigure the access road layout. Previously, access to Plot 2 was proposed as a 7.3m wide carriageway adjoining the main access into Plot 1 from Holland Road. The access road ran through the centre of Plot 2 in between Units 1 and 2. It included a 3.5m wide cycle / footpath on the southern side of the road and a 2m wide pavement on the north. Provision was made for future access into Plot 5 to the east and a turning head was included in the east of the plot. The revised layout seeks to re-align the access road so that it sits to the north of Unit 1 rather than through the middle of Units 1 and 2. The cycle / footways, potential future access into Plot 5 and the turning head will all be retained. This change will displace an area of hardstanding and a total of 12 standard parking spaces in the north of Plot 2. These parking spaces will now be accommodated on the western side of Plot 2, meaning that there is no nett loss in parking spaces. An access between Units 1 and 2 is maintained to allow a full turning circle for vehicles to use the site operating on a one way system.

    Non-material minor amendment to planning consent 2316/24/FUL to reconfigure the access road layout into Plot 1. Previously, access to plot 1 was proposed as 6m wide carriageway from Holland Road into the site. The access included a 3.5m wide cycle / footpath on the eastern side of the road and a 2m wide pavement on the west. The access was aligned south – north from Holland road into the site for the first approximately 50m before it turned east into the adjacent land parcel (known as Plot 2). The revised layout seeks to widen the access to 7.3m (whilst maintaining the cycle / footways) so that two HGVs can comfortably pass each other, making the site safer and more easily accessible for larger vehicles. The access is now also proposed to run south to north for approximately 100m before turning into Plot 2 at the northern edge of Plot 1.
